About Borlaug Institute

 

The Borlaug Institute, affiliated with Texas A&M University System (TAMUS), leads international food security and agricultural development initiatives. Named in honor of the Nobel Peace Prize laureate, Dr. Norman Borlaug, the Institute continues his legacy by advancing global food security, livelihoods, and resilience through applied agricultural science, research, and extension. Its mission is to uplift small-holder farmers from poverty and hunger through agricultural innovation.

Project Background

The Norman Borlaug Institute for International Agriculture and Development has secured a fund from USAID to implement the Young Women Lead (YWL) program from September 28, 2023, to September 27, 2025. This program aims to empower young Afghan women to successfully complete short tertiary trainings and professional development programs, equipping them with skills and connections vital for pursuing careers in Afghanistan. Additionally, it fosters a supportive, inclusive environment, promoting collaboration and peer-to-peer learning among participants.
